I took one slightly oily, the other was in a velvet wrap with no hint of oil. And I really liked the velvet wrapper, it was as soft and velvety to taste 5/5 stars. Second - I want to smoke today. The wrapper is slightly oily. The aroma of the wrapper is sweet leather. Such smells case have ladies gloves from tender suede skin (at Polish lajka/lojka). 1/3: immediately good powerful smoke, but the taste of bitter wrapper on the lips is distracting. I wipe the saliva off the wrapper and the bitterness almost disappears. This often happens, may be the glue... Back to the cigar: the taste is soft, dominated by leather and oak, very similar to aged whiskey. I leave the room for 3 minutes and with a fresh nose I feel a great aroma, something close to the smell of fresh rye bread. There is a lot of smoke, it is of medium density and beautifully shimmers in the air. Contemplation of smoke is one of the reasons I like to smoke indoors. The taste can not boast of different gastronomic components, but the roundness and complexity of the taste is one of the features of limitadas. Appears in the taste of almond bitterness. Towards the end of 1/3 appear cream. The ash is not even, but I only corrected it once, after I broke it, it became clear that the smolder cone is shifted to the wrapper. This is a roller error often occurs when the filling is shifted from the center. In this case, it is not critical for the burning of the Cigar. 2/3 ash Removal, as is often the case, gave impetus to the evolution of taste: it is a wood-creamy almond refreshing mix, like a drink. But in General, no component is dominant, the taste is very smooth without sharp corners. Towards the end of 2/3 the taste becomes velvety and soft again. Bitter almond aftertaste. 3/3: the taste has not changed, but the smoke has become very rich, I switch to delicate slow puffs. A wonderful mix of flavors. This cigar can be smoked to the end and it will not bring unpleasant moments. Conclusion: the cigar was enjoyable, I give it an 5/5. A very interesting experience with different wrapper confirmed my opinion that not only the oily wrapper gives a great taste. 9 3

BuzzArd Posted April 9, 2019 Posted April 9, 2019 Nice review. In fact, I always like your reviews. Very insightful. I have several boxes of these. I love the size and smoking time. I have found, however, that of the 6 or 7 i’ve had from the first open box that all but one was underfilled. Frustrating in a regular production cigar, but doubly so in a EL where you would think extra attention was given to “get it perfect”. How did you find either of yours with regard to construction overall (aside from what was mentioned already and especially the fill? 1

How did you find either of yours with regard to construction overall (aside from what was mentioned already and especially the fill? Thank youUnfortunately defective Limitadas are not uncommon. Many Cohiba Talisman, sold in Russia were with tunnels and not enough filler. My Cuban friends tell me that Limitadas are often rolled at the secondary factories. Also, allegedly, a good tobacco steal, instead lay spoofing or put not enough of filler.As for the Regios de Punch, I have no claims to the construction, despite the fact that it was the remains of what was not taken by other buyers. 1
